60 EN Troubleshooting (Continued) Trouble Action ੬ Recording (Continued) The LCD monitor indications blink. ● Certain modes of program AE, effect, DIS, and other functions - that cannot be used together are selected at the same time. Digital zoom does not ● Set [ZOOM] to [64X] or [800X]. 55 work. ● Digital zoom is not available in the still image recording mode. - The recorded image is ● In bright places, setting "Nightalive" or a slow speed is not 24 white. recommended. The focus is not ● Set focus to the automatic mode. 23 adjusted automatically. ● Clean the lens and check the focus again. 64 The color of the image ● Try manual white balance adjustment. 23 looks strange. The recorded image is ● Try backlight compensation or manual exposure. 23 too dark. 25 The recorded image is ● Try manual exposure. 23 too bright. White balance setting ● Do not select the sepia (SEPIA) or monotone (MONOTONE) 24 cannot be activated. mode before setting white balance. The continuous ● The continuous shooting speed will drop when repeatedly making - shooting speed of still continuous shots, when using certain recording media, or under images is slow. certain recording conditions. Playback Playback cannot be performed. ● Select the recording medium properly. 15 ● To watch images on a TV, set the TV's input mode or channel that 32 is appropriate for video playback. The same image is ● The surface of the disk or card is damaged. It is recommended to - displayed for a long run check disk regularly on the PC, providing that there is no data time during video on the hard disk of the camera. playback, or motion is choppy. The black & white fader ● Do not select the sepia (SEPIA) or monotone (MONOTONE) 35 does not work. mode. There is a noise during ● The sound of the hard disk drive may have been recorded if the - playback. camera was moved suddenly during recording. Do not move or shake the camera suddenly during recording.
